6580761326345586036566593332885844758558
Even
6580761326345586036566593332885844758558 is even
Previous even number is 6580761326345586036566593332885844758556
Next even number is 6580761326345586036566593332885844758560
Cubed
284989211512063832627831906586991107287323719963184831014641833592317729423513304742168978406319167208157727529999477112
Squared
43306419634325716724605548165919029104109710921929562283732946406776681314239364
Binary
1001101010110110100001000011110001111000111000100100010110111011001110011001000101101001111000111001111001101111011011001000000011110